I'd rather see "git am" hardcode as little such policy as possible. > We do need to support S-o-b footer and the policy we defined for it long time > ago, if only for backward compatiblity, but for any other footers, > policy decision > such as "dedup by default" isn't something "am" should know about. By the way, "append without looking for dups" is a policy decision that is as bad to have as "append with dedup". I'd rather not to see "am.signoff", or any name that implies what the "-s" option to the command is about for that matter, to be used in futzing with the trailers other than S-o-b in any way. As I understand it, our longer term goal is to defer that task, including the user-programmable policy decisions, to something like the 'trailer' Christian started. I suspect that it may add unnecessary work later if we overloaded "signoff" with a similar feature with the change under discussion. I would feel safer to see it outlined how we envision to transition to a more generic 'trailer' solution later if we were to enhance "am" with "am.signoff" now. Thanks.
